Face to face cell talk soon
Source: Hueiyen News Service / Shyamchand
Imphal, April 27 2009:
The Bharat Sansar Nigam Limited (BSNL) is getting ready to install a Mobile Switching Centre with improve Third Generation Mobile Service in Manipur apart from replacing the Base Transmitter Station (BTS) currently in service by more sophisticated Ericson BTS which will provide more improve service to the BSNL subscribers in the state.
An official source disclosed Hueiyen Lanpao said that separate Mobile Switching Centre in the state is to be installed in the state in order to reduce the work load at Shillong controlling the entire north east circle of the BSNL.
And after the replacement of the currently in use BTS by the Third Generation (TG) Mobile Service will allow use of broad band internet through mobile with the speed not below 255 Kilo bite per second (KBPS).
It also will provide the facilities of use of multi-media, uploading and downloading of video clippings etc.
Apart from this, with the help of TG server, mobile handset with video camera can enjoy face to face talking through the mobile phone.
Source further said that within the three month period of time, BTS 33 towers will be installing at various places in Imphal area to provide the facilities with TG in phase-wise manner and by replacing the BTS of the WLL currently in use by EVDO, board band internet facilities will be made available to the customers.
Eighty percent of installation works for replacement of the BTS by Ericson BTS has so far completed and targeting to complete the remaining 20% work by next month, officials of the BSNL, Imphal disclosed.
Problems and inconveniences will cause to the mobile customers owing the upgradation process and replacement of the older one by latest equipments.

BSNL is planning to provide broad band service by installing exchange centres at 30 places including at every district headquarters.
The lowest speed of the service will be of 255 kilo-bite and the highest will be 8 mega bites.
Under the broad band service, facilities of web conference, video conference, audio conference, power point sharing, file sharing, chatting and wide board will be provided, the officials disclosed.
